James “Jim” Alton Blankenship, age 78 of Griffin Georgia passed away Thursday, May 21, 2020 at Brightmoor Hospice after a long battle with cancer and pulmonary fibrosis. He passed away on his 60th wedding anniversary. His loving wife, Linda cared for him at home giving him the best of care until May 18, 2020 when his health severely deteriorated.
Jim was born June 30, 1941 in Etowah, Tennessee. He is preceded in death by his parents James and Edith Blankenship; brother, Freddie Blankenship. He is survived by his wife, Linda, daughter Tammy (Kenny) Russell, daughter Cathy (Greg) Petty, special grandson Adam (Sabrina) Caldwell, Blake Russell, Ben Russell, Shane (Brittany) Petty; great-grandchildren Ava Caldwell, Jack Caldwell, Shadoe Thompson, Layla Petty, and Londyn Petty. Jim is also survived by his siblings, Joyce Casteel, Richard Blankenship, Carroll Blankenship, Eddie Blankenship and Patti Smith all of Tennessee.
Jim retired from General Motors in Lakewood, Georgia and returned to work at Perdue’s Paint and Body shop before permanently retiring. Jim was a member of Westside Church of Christ in Griffin, Georgia. He was a Christian who loved his father in Heaven. A graveside service will be on Saturday, May 23, 2020 at 3:00 pm at Westminster Memorial gardens, Peachtree City with Jim Lane and Kenny Russell officiating the service.
